Action item from the Stormlace fan-out incident: during the squall-line event, the alert dispatcher retried failed pushes with no jitter, so every regional worker hammered the notification tier in lockstep and we dropped roughly a third of alerts for the Harrowfield zone. New folks: the fan-out layer is the only component allowed to retry; downstream services must fail fast. We're codifying backoff, jitter, and per-zone concurrency caps as reviewed constants rather than env overrides. The agreed values follow for the record.

tuning constants:
QUOTAS = {
    "druwyn": 5,
    "holix": 5,
    "zorath": 5,
    "holwyn": 10,
}

## Build Provenance: Gatewright Rate Limiter

The Gatewright gateway enforces per-tenant rate limits via the Throttlekit module, compiled into each gateway release. If on-call sees unexpected 429 spikes, first confirm which limiter build is deployed, since limits are baked in at compile time rather than fetched at runtime. Rollbacks must target the limiter build, not the gateway shell. The currently deployed limiter build is recorded below.

session token of kafof-kafop = htk31_c3becf8b8eac3ed970037fba36e258e

## Changelog — Quotline Gateway v4.2

We've changed the default per-tenant rate quotas. New tenants now start at a lower baseline, and burst allowances are calculated per region rather than globally. If you onboarded before this release, nothing changes for existing tenants, but any tenant created going forward will inherit the new defaults automatically. Please review these carefully before provisioning, since support tickets about throttling usually trace back here. The current default quota configuration is as follows.

config for kafof-bawef:
holath:
  log_level: debug
  metrics_host: metrics.holath.qorvelsys.internal
  pin: 2191
  pool_size: 32